Compiler Error C2720
'identifier' : 'specifier' storage-class specifier illegal on members
The storage class cannot be used on class members outside the declaration. To fix this error, remove the unneeded storage class specifier from the definition of the member outside the class declaration.
Example
The following sample generates C2720 and shows how to fix it:
// C2720.cpp
struct S {
static int i;
};
static S::i; // C2720 - remove the unneeded 'static' to fix it
